Iron Engrams should include weapons

Honestly going into non leveled crucible and especially sweats and scrims can be absolute hell for me since I don't have a matador or a felwinters lie. It kind of sucks that these guns that were absolute kings and were defining are no longer available at all. It mainly comes down to reroll ability since I'd love to have a god shotgun like seemingly everyone else but the one time I got rangefinder on my party crasher it came without any range upgrade in the middle column. Honestly if bungie wants to do balancing, then you should create an available route to get these guns again and one way would be to return weapons like felwinters lie in iron engrams.
